Edfinity allows you to easily share your section with any colleagues or collaborators, including teaching assistants (TAs) and tutors.
To share your course with others, go to the course. Select Share.
Adding a course collaborator
To share your course with a collaborator, enter the email addresses of the educator with whom you want to share your course. In addition, specify the level of access (view or edit) to your course.
Access level | Course access |
---|---|
View |
Use view-level access if you want collaborators to be able to access your course material without being able to see your students.
|
Edit |
Use edit-level access if you want to collaborate on course construction or if you have want someone to be able to help you with day-to-day course management (e.g. a TA).
|
Repeat the above steps for each collaborator. Select Send to invite collaborators to your course. They will receive an email and be asked to sign up for an Edfinity account if they do not already have one. They will see the course in their Courses Taught.
Editing the access level for a course collaborator
You can change the access level a collaborator has to your course by using the access dropdown.
Removing a course collaborator
To remove a collaborator from your course, click the X button next to the name of the collaborator. Access to the course will revoked immediately.
